(Requested by Augusta Law Department) Attachments Engineering Services Committee Meeting 2/24/2014 1:05 PM GDOT Local Maintenance & Improvement Grant Street/Road Resurfacing Contract Award 13-197 Department:Abie Ladson, Director Caption:Approve award of Construction Contract to Beam’s Contracting, Inc., in the amount of $1,328,099.80 for GDOT LMIG funded resurfacing projects, subject to receipt of signed contracts and proper bonds as requested by AED. Bid 13-197 Background:The Local Maintenance and Improvement Grant is an annual formula-based grant from GDOT that is funded through the motor fuel tax. Grant funds are typically used to supplement local resurfacing efforts based on priority. Each year Augusta receives approximately $1.5 million through this grant, and Augusta provides a ten percent match. The funds have been granted through GDOT fiscal year 2013, and will provide resurfacing for twelve (12) roads within the county. Analysis:Bids were received on October 3, 2013 with Reeves Construction Company being the low bidder. The bid results are as follow: CONTRACTORS BID 1. Reeves Construction Company $963,548.82 2. Beam’s Contracting $1,328,099.80 After evaluations of the bids, Reeves Construction determined that they could not complete the project for $963,548.82. Beam’s Contracting was the next low bidder, and their bid is within the budgeted amount of $1,727,922.04. It is the recommendation of the Engineering Department to award this project to Beam’s Contracting. Financial Impact:Funds of $1,570,838.22 are available through GDOT Local Maintenance & Improvement Grant, and $157,083.82 through the Transportation Investment Act (TIA) for the City of Augusta, GA matching funds. (Requested by Augusta Law Department) Background:Brandenburg-Walker Street, LLC has requested that Telfair Lane, as shown on the attached plat be abandoned due to the fact that the property is an old alleyway which currently bisects their parcels. The abandonment request has been reviewed by all essential county departments and administrators and approvals were received to this abandonment request. Pursuant to O.C.G.A. §32-7-2, a public hearing was held on September 30, 2013 for this matter. The legal description and plat of said portion of Telfair Lane are attached. Analysis:In addition to the information provided in the above Background section, results of the public hearing will be presented to the Commission. Notice to the property owners located thereon has been provided, pursuant to O.C.G.A. §32-7-2(b)(1).
